Key takeaway This report covers the period from 1 May to 30 June 2026 and provides information on the humanitarian crisis in Sudan.
Conflict has severely impacted local communities, damaging essential infrastructure. Many areas are now isolated, including regions such as Darfur and Blue Nile. Further details are available from the UNFPA Sudan Situation Report.
This report covers the period from 1 May to 30 June 2026 and provides information on the humanitarian crisis in Sudan. Limited access to health services and increased threats to women and girls are among the challenges faced by the local population, with many people returning to areas with destroyed infrastructure.
